Primer vistazo: el simulador de agricultura llega a la realidad virtual

¡Prepárate para una experiencia agrícola aún más inmersiva! Giants Software ha anunciado el simulador de agricultura VR, un juego de realidad virtual que da vida al mundo agrícola como nunca antes.

Esta "nueva experiencia agrícola" promete un realismo incomparable. Los jugadores manejarán todos los aspectos de la vida agrícola, desde plantar y cosechar cultivos con maquinaria realista hasta invernaderos cuidados y mantener su equipo. El objetivo? Construye una granja próspera y próspera.

El anuncio se ha recibido con respuestas entusiastas de los fanáticos. ¡Muchos ven el valor educativo potencial en la experiencia de la realidad virtual, mientras que otros ya están contemplando las consecuencias (potencialmente peligrosas) de acercarse demasiado a una cosechadora!

Farming Simulator VR se lanza el 28 de febrero, exclusivamente para Meta Quest 2, Quest 3, Quest 3s y Quest Pro auriculares.

¿Qué pueden esperar los agricultores virtuales? El software de los gigantes promete un ciclo agrícola completo, que incluye plantación, cosecha, empaque y venta de productos. También se presenta el cultivo de invernadero de tomates, berenjenas, fresas y más. El juego incluirá maquinaria con licencia oficial de fabricantes líderes como Case IH, Claas, Fendt y John Deere. Los jugadores incluso podrán reparar y mantener sus máquinas en un taller dedicado, agregando otra capa de autenticidad. Y para lo último en el realismo, ¡espere lavar a presión!
